Health Care Communication Provider Rights and Responsibilities

Federal, state, and local laws guarantee the communication rights of hard of hearing and deaf patients, but access to effective communication remains a significant challenge, leading to healthcare disparities. Despite regulations from the ADA and accreditation bodies, ensuring that patients receive understandable and accurate health information continues to be a critical issue, as highlighted by the Consumer Bill of Rights and Responsibilities.
